If you want to put your skills to work where the stakes are real and the mission is bigger than any one person, forge the future with Voyager. ____________________________________________________________________________________ Job Summary: The Senior Edge Computing Engineer is a hands-on developer role responsible for the core performance of our fielded systems. You will own critical subsystems, utilizing advanced GPGPU techniques to process high-velocity data streams in real-time. You will work with minimal supervision to architect and implement solutions that run on diverse hardware targets, from multi-GPU rackmount servers to power-constrained embedded modules. Responsibilities: This position requires the candidate to perform software engineering tasks: High-Performance Computing: Design and implement high-throughput processing pipelines using Modern C++ and GPU-accelerated frameworks (e.g., CUDA, Holoscan, ROCm). Kernel Optimization: Write and optimize custom GPU kernels for signal processing operations, managing memory coalescing and host-to-device data transfers to minimize latency. System Profiling: Profile full-stack software performance to identify CPU/GPU bottlenecks, optimizing memory usage and PCIe bandwidth utilization. Hardware Abstraction: Design software interfaces that abstract specific hardware peripherals, ensuring our GPU-based algorithms can run on a variety of radio and sensor platforms. Edge Infrastructure: Manage the build and deployment pipelines for embedded Linux operating systems, ensuring fielded systems correctly expose accelerator resources to containerized applications.
